Kitzbühel, Austria, in March offers a captivating blend of winter chill and hints of spring warmth. With maximum temperatures reaching 17°C (62°F) and an average of 1°C (34°F), this picturesque town sees a frigid minimum of -19°C (-2°F), creating a diverse climate. The month experiences significant precipitation, totaling 118 mm (4.6 in) over approximately 16 rainy days, contributing to a high humidity level of 86%. When comparing the weather in March and January, it is evident that March offers a milder climate. In March, temperatures range from a minimum of -19°C (-2°F) to a maximum of 17°C (62°F), with an average of around 1°C (34°F). In contrast, January experiences much colder conditions, with temperatures dipping as low as -29°C (-20°F) and only reaching up to 9°C (48°F), averaging -4°C (25°F). Precipitation levels are somewhat similar, with March receiving 118 mm (4.6 in) over 16 days, while January sees a slightly higher total of 123 mm (4.9 in) across 13 days.
